KISS’s restaurant chain rocks out with VUE Audiotechnik i8 speakers

As befits a restaurant chain founded by KISS legends Gene Simmons and Paul Stanley, Rock & Brews restaurants serve up food and craft beers in a setting reminiscent of a classic rock concert. Each location boasts a backstage environment showcasing iconic rock art, concert trusses and stage lighting and numerous HD LED flatscreens sharing some of rock’s all-time-greatest concert moments.

Named the seventh fastest-growing chain in 2015 by Restaurant Business Magazine, Rock & Brews’ expansion recently encompassed two new locations in California. Jon Mesko, southern California Rock & Brews franchise partner, turned to CBC Technical’s vice president David Meek to design the systems for his two new 200-capacity locations in Corona and Rancho Cucamonga, California.

Given the need for intelligibility in the high ambient-noise spaces, Meek and the CBC team selected full-range VUE i8 two-way loudspeakers to anchor each system. They deployed a total of 33 i8s in Corona and 24 i8s in Rancho Cucamonga.

“First off, Rock & Brews play nothing but classic rock so the sound had to be extraordinary,” explained Meek. “But even more importantly, intelligibility of the lyrics was paramount. You can turn the VUEs up enough to hear the vocals without blowing everyone away.”

Meek also specified the VUE i8 class due to their ease of installation and out-of-box performance. “The i8s use good old U brackets which you can do just about anything with – they installed on the already-existing truss like a breeze. Meek also praised the i8’s flat frequency response: “One thing I’ve noticed is that everything from VUE is QC’d – every speaker comes out of the box and works; we run the systems fairly flat because the frequency response is so flat.”

Feedback from patrons, and Mesko, has been nothing but positive. “The client absolutely loves how each restaurant sounds,” said Meek. “It was a real honour to design the systems that deliver the truest classic rock experience to hundreds of patrons each day.”
